As a teacher, Light Vehicle, Automotive & Supply Management, your key responsibilities include
- Plan education practices and delivery sessions that reflect the most effective way to engage learners
- Ensure that teaching materials and resources meet all regulatory standards, training packages and related requirements
- Establish and maintain a positive learning environment, including encouraging students to take responsibility for their own learning
- Adapt learning and assessment materials to cater for different students, learning environments, facilities, and resources
- Undertake a range of administrative, coordination, and learning services activities directly related to the areas taught
- Assist in relation to the establishment, maintenance, and review of teaching programs
- Maintain a respectful, and safe environment free from discrimination, bullying and harassment.

**ABOUT YOU**

You are a highly motivated individual with well-developed skills in transferring knowledge, including the ability to research, select and use a wide range of learning resources and assessment tools.

**Qualifications required for the role**
- Certificate IV in Training and Assessment (TAE40122) or qualifications that meet the Standards for RTOs 2015
- Vocational qualifications at AQF level Certificate III or above in relevant Automotive/Engineering field or apprenticeship indentures
- Registration with relevant professional bodies as required for the teaching discipline
- A record of Vocational Competency, mapped to Units of Competency engaged to deliver
- A record of Professional Currency, demonstrating current industry and teaching knowledge.
